About the DRE Citadel EVS Vessel Sealing System
The Citadel EVS combines vessel sealing and bipolar electrosurgery modes in one microprocessor-controlled unit, eliminating the need for multiple ESU systems during complex procedures. Unlike standard bipolar units that require constant manual adjustments, this system automatically modulates power delivery based on real-time tissue feedback.
6Sense Technology monitors voltage, current, power, tissue density, and RF leakage simultaneously, giving you continuous feedback on seal quality and tissue response. Audio alarms signal completion of bipolar coagulation, reducing the guesswork that leads to tissue charring or instrument sticking. The short version: it tells you when to stop.
Program settings customize easily for different procedure types, and the compact footprint won’t crowd your existing OR setup. Worth noting, the system weighs under 5kg and operates reliably in standard OR environmental conditions.

Specifications for DRE Citadel EVS Vessel Sealing System
Outputs
- Bipolar Micro: 95 W at 100 Ω, CF 1.5
- Vessel Sealer (Sealer): 150 W at 100 Ω, CF 1.5
Dimensions
- Length: 38 cm
- Width: 30.5 cm
- Height: 11.5 cm
Weight
- Weight: < 5.0 kg
Transport & Storage
- Temperature Range: -40°C to 70°C
- Relative Humidity: 10% to 100%, condensing
Operating Parameters
- Temperature Range: 10°C to 40°C
- Relative Humidity: 30% to 75%, non-condensing
Audio
- Activation Tone: Volume (adjustable): 50 to ≥ 65 dB
- Activation Tone: Frequency (Bipolar): 940 Hz
- Alarm Tone: Volume (not adjustable): ≥ 65 dB
- Alarm Tone: Frequency: 660 Hz
- Alarm Tone: Pulse: Two Pulse 1 sec ON time, 1 sec OFF time
Power
- Mains Nominal Voltage: 110 Volt
- Maximum VA at Nominal Line Voltage: Idle: 60 VA | Bipolar: 360 VA | Cut: 816 VA | Coag: 480 VA
- Input Mains Voltage, Full Regulation Range: 90-135 Vac
- Input Mains Voltage, Operating Range: 80-140 Vac
- Mains Current (Maximum): Idle: 0.4 A | Bipolar: 2.6 A | Cut: 6.4 A | Coag: 3.6 A
- Mains Line Frequency Range (Nominal): 50 to 60 Hz
- Fusing: 10 A
- Power Cord: 3-prong standard connector
General
- Warm-up Time: Allow one hour for the generator to reach room temperature before use if transported or stored outside the operating temperature range
- Internal Memory: Non-volatile
- High Frequency (RF) Leakage Current: Bipolar RF leakage current: < 60 mA RMS
